Established in 1953, Seven Hills Behavioral Health, with its headquarters in Milford, Massachusetts, is committed to providing comprehensive and integrated treatment to both children and adults. The organization is renowned for its multifaceted programs, which cover all aspects of children’s health, including physical and behavioral health. In order to guarantee comprehensive assistance for children, these initiatives necessitate partnerships with healthcare professionals and educational institutions.
A medical center that serves adolescents and young adults up to the age of 22 is operated by Seven Hills Behavioral Health. A multidisciplinary approach is employed by this facility to address developmental delays and complex medical requirements, which includes the participation of skilled nursing staff as essential members of the care team.
Seven Hills Behavioral Health provides a variety of therapeutic services for adults, such as individual, couples, and family counseling. Furthermore, home-based counseling services are accessible to offer personalized assistance that is adaptable to the unique requirements of each client.
In addition, the organization is dedicated to improving the well-being of the community by organizing health promotion initiatives. Its commitment to comprehensive and inclusive healthcare is evidenced by its expansion of its services to encompass dental care for both children and adults with developmental disabilities.
